Position Summary:


The ELL teacher assesses the needs of students and provides support so students can access and master gradelevel standards. The ELL teacher collaborates with general education or content teachers to coplan codeliver and individualize instruction for all students in a class; work together creatively to accommodate the language proficiencies cultural diversity and educational backgrounds of the students in the class; and overcome instructional challenges constructively. The ELL teacher must be comfortable sharing ideas modeling strategies coplanning coteaching and providing coaching to colleagues. The ELL teacher is a hardworking goaloriented and enthusiastic professional with excellent subject knowledge and a sound understanding of the Missouri Learning Standards and Common Core State Standards.


Position Responsibilities:


  • Perform educational assessments of students including an observation of the student review of the students educational history conferences with the students teachers and parents and an evaluation and analysis of the students academic performance and learning characteristics.
  • Use language teaching strategies to increase English Proficiency for students who speak a language other than English at home
  • Report educational assessment findings to parents classroom teachers supervisor and administration. Complete quarterly progress reports on each student in the program.
  • Provides individual and small group pushin or pullout instruction based on creating a schedule that best meets the language needs of students.
  • Actively participate in the deliberations and classification of ELL students and assists in planning coordinating developing monitoring and evaluating as assigned.
  • Maintain confidential records on all referred students and student/parent contacts in accordance with federal and state law Board policy and the procedure of the schools ELL education program.
  • Provide thorough and timely reports data and information and make sure the ELL Department stays in compliance with federal/state rules and regulations.
  • Serve as a resource to school personnel on the nature causes and solutions of English language acquisition problems of students.
